#4577 From: James <james.traynor@...>
Date: Tue Nov 17, 2009 10:13 pm
Subject: Re: xAP Jabber bug?
JamesTraynor
Offline Offline
Send Email Send Email
 
Hi,

Yes that's a bit unusual.  In theory when you have multiple xmpp connections the one with the highest priority, which is usually the one with the last activity, would be the one to appear in the roster. When receiving a message it should only come from the resource that sent the message, quite why google is sending all the logins is a bit odd!


should clean the issue up, just replace the exe with the one you have already got. The resource names will still be there as they are used by other apps but it should all stay on the one line and so make a valid message each time.


hth

James


On 17 Nov 2009, at 16:16, david.earls wrote:

 

Firstly, I feel a bit guilty about asking for a bug-fix when I have never got round to thanking anyone for the xAP bits I use every day (xAP Floorplan, xAP X10 Connector, xAP MCS 1-Wire, xAP MCS CID, xap MCS K3145, xAP MCS WOL, xAP Jabber), but here goes anyway.

xAP Jabber 0.5 is connecting to the XMPP network, sending, receiving and showing status perfectly, but when I send it a IM it produces a malformed xAP message:

------------------------
The following message caused an error during its processing.
Name/value pair contains no valid separator characters
The message was received from 127.0.0.1:58809

------------
xap-header
{
v=12
hop=1
uid=FF111300
Class=messenger.event
Source=mi4.jabber.Jabber
}
Message.Receive
{
From=blah@googlemail.com/Talk.v104659BEEDB
Talk.v104555C3C06
gmail.EB49AA97
palringo0589DD3D
gmail.FF7F215B
gmail.FF7F6118
Talk.v104C7BB0132
Body=blah blah
}

------------
The error that was generated is as follows:
Name/value pair contains no valid separator characters

Source: xFx
Name/value pair contains no valid separator characters
KCS.xAP.Framework.xAPMessageReaderException: Name/value pair contains no valid separator characters
at KCS.xAP.Framework.Message.xAPInfo.GetPairValueEncodingFormat(String line, Int32 line_number)
at KCS.xAP.Framework.Message.xAPMessageReader.ReadMessagePair(xAPMessage message, String line)
at KCS.xAP.Framework.Message.xAPMessageReader.ReadMessage()
at KCS.xAP.Framework.Transport.xAPListener.ProcessQueuedMessage(xAPRawData data)
------------------------

I think this is because xAP Jabber wasn't expecting the sender to be online on multiple devices. The different locations are appearing on separate lines after the sender's email address. Would it be possible to get xAP Jabber to strip everything after the email address?

Daniel Berenguer wrote:
>
> Hi xAP people.
>
> The first xAP BSC extension for MyOpenLab has just been released:
>
> http://sites.google.com/a/usapiens.com/opnode/products/myopenlab
> <http://sites.google.com/a/usapiens.com/opnode/products/myopenlab>
>
> MyOpenLab is an open platform for doing simulations, graphical
> programmings and visual interfaces. It's written in Java so it can be
> run on many OS's. The great thing about MyOpenLab is that complex
> programmings can be done just placing and linking visual components on
> a project sheet. I thought that this software could find a place among
> the xAP community when I first evaluated it some months ago as some
> xAP/opnode users have reported to me the need for such graphical tool
> for their projects.
>
> Those having worked with LabView and Simulink will appreciate the work
> done by Carmelo Salafia, the author of this great open project. For
> those having never worked with a graphical programming tool, you'll
> find a simple way of avoiding hand-coding scripts and creating custom
> graphical interfaces for your Home Automation projects :-D
>
> Anyway, the new xAP extension for MyOpenLab is a very first beta
> version. I still need some help from you in order to bring this
> development into a usable/productive stage.
>
> For further information about MyOpenLab please visit
> http://www.myopenlab.de/ <http://www.myopenlab.de/>
>
> Best regards,

I hope the suggestions do provide a solution that works for you.

It's a shame that Mikko has not interacted with the xAP community in a
way that would have ensured LogTemp adhered to the specification.
Although I haven't used his application it appears from the messages you
posted that his TSC implementation is not going to work.  I am unsure
that he has implemented the bidirectional data exchange either but FTTB
let's assume that bit works.

  The TSC specification is documented in great detail here
http://www.xapautomation.org/index.php?title=xAP_Telemetry_Status_and_Control_Sc\
hema
and it is derived from our heavily used BSC specification again
documented in great detail here
http://www.xapautomation.org/index.php?title=Basic_Status_and_Control_Schema
which supplements the standard xAP specification document.

As I posted on the xAP developers list I am happy to work with Mikko to
try and get his application compliant with the specifications but only
if the schema specification is met is there any possibility that his
application will interact with other xAP applications supporting TSC.
My recommendation to him would be to support either BSC or TSC via a
selectable dropdown for maximum plug and play interoperability currently
but TSC alone is viable.  Failing that he could just present his data
using an informational schema ( a list of values). This is possibly what
the 'own message for each sensor' option already does . Nearly all these
informational schema are supportable in nearly all applications eg
HomeSeer, Charmed Quark, xAP Floorplan, HouseBot, Cortex,  Girder(?)
,MisterHouse(?)  etc although the OPNMax embedded controller is BSC
centric.  However the problem comes when you implement a standard schema
incorrectly.

I hope Mikko will refine the xAP TSC support within his application as
it looks to be a great application , and particularly useful for the
logging aspects. However should he not be wanting to do that then it
would be better if he did withdraw xAP support altogether as presenting
invalid xAP schema doesn't help anyone.  Should he do this and if you
are in need of 1-wire sensor information presented on xAP then there are
several other applications that already offer this , and even a couple
of standalone embedded 1-wire controllers with xAP support. These work
well with xAP Floorplan etc.

Supporting xAP allows your device to immediately integrate with most of
the leading HA applications without you having to write and maintain
your own plugins for each application - an attractive proposition.

    K
